[Connection] Wearable Design Lesson Plan



Computational Fashion @ Eyebeam
For this lesson, a class of 11th grade students will be visiting Eyebeam Art + Technology Center for a field trip. Students would look at various artists who use digital media creatively as a general introduction, and then participate in a workshop on the theme of Computational Fashion, an Eyebeam initiative bringing together artists, fashion designers, scientists, and technologists to explore emerging ideas and develop new work at the intersection of fashion and technology. Students will have the choice to participate in one of the 3 workshops: 

1) Smart Textiles: Fashion That Responds 

2) "Fashion and the Body" Panel + Wearable Tech Demo

3) Costumes as Game Controllers: The Lightning Bug Game

Students will write a reflective paper on their expereince in the workshop oulinging what they learned and what role and impact does wearable technology play and have in current world? Students will be separated into 3 groups for a short presentation introducing their workshops to others who haven't had the chance to participate.
